Artist Bio

Larry Marshall

(Bio as of August 2013)

Larry Marshall was recently nominated for a Helen Hayes Award for Outstanding Lead Actor in a Resident Play for his role as Monroe in Pullman Porter Blues at Arena Stage in Washington, DC. He has appeared on Broadway in The Color Purple as Ol’ Mister, Hair, Inner City, Two Gentlemen of Verona, Rockabye Hamlet, Comin’ Uptown, A Broadway Musical, Oh Brother!, Big Deal, Play On!, The Full Monty and as Sportin’ Life in Porgy and Bess, for which he was nominated for Tony and Drama Desk award . In the summer of 2006, he appeared with Meryl Streep as the General and the Farmer in Mother Courage and Her Children at the Delacorte Theater in Central Park. Most recently, Mr. Marshall appeared as Mayor Shinn in The Harbor Lights Theater Company’s production of The Music Man, and has appeared as Danny in the national tour of Xanadu. His movie credits include Jesus Christ Superstar, The Cotton Club, Showtime’s Keep the Faith, Baby and the Showtime series Soul Food.
